Figure 11.

Assessment of Ca 2+ dynamics in IALVs from control and Ip3r1ismKO mice using GCaMP6f. Ca2+ was recorded over 20–30 s at 20 fps in pressurized and contracting IALVs from MyH11CreERT2-GCaMp6f mice or Ip3r1ismKO-GCaMP6f mice (Videos 3 and 4). (A and B) Representative maximum projections of the lymphatic muscle Ca2+ signal and outline of individual lymphatic muscle cells for analysis. Scale bars are 50 μm. (C and D) Plot profiles and their respective space-time maps of Ca2+ over time (x-axis) from the outlined cells in A and B for IALVs from MyH11CreERT2-GCaMp6f mice or Ip3r1ismKO-GCaMP6f mice, respectively. (E and G) Analysis of the Ca2+ flash associated with contraction for (E) frequency, (F) amplitude, and (G) duration as assessed by full width at half-maximum. (H) Lymphatic muscle cells in IALVs from Ip3r1ismKO mice largely lack diastolic Ca2+ transients (pink and orange arrow heads in C, green arrowheads in D) and the number of analyzed cells that displayed diastolic Ca2+ transients (H) in either IALVs from MyH11CreERT2-GCaMp6f mice or Ip3r1ismKO-GCaMP6f mice were tabulated. n = 8 MyH11CreERT2-GCaMp6f and n = 9 Ip3r1ismKO-GCaMp6f IALVs with mean and SEM shown and stated explicitly beneath the graphs.
